1N4007 diode: key component in electronic circuits
The 1N4007 rectifier diode belongs to a series of high-power rectifier diodes made of silicon materials. Its main feature is that it can withstand high peak reverse voltage and average rectifier current. Specifically, the maximum peak reverse voltage (VRM) of 1N4007 is 1000V, the average rectifier current (IF(AV)) is 1A, and it operates in the temperature range of -65°C to +175°C.
